I use the exterior latex redwood stain on my picnic tables. works pretty good.
later today I'll find what I used on the deck & let you know.-- on the dexk I use Wolman F & P Wood finish & Preservative. It is called: natural # 14396 but it has a brown tint. Didn't realize that when I first used it, but now I am committed. There are other tints. It lasts about 2 years. it protects against: Rot & Decay, Mold & Mildew. Water Damage, & UV Graying. NOTE: You have to let new treated lumber "season"--for 6 months I think it is, before you put any kind of paint or stain on it.--Your lumber yard will know how long you need to wait. But be sure to ask, because after you spend the $$ on a new board, you do not want it to go bad----
